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2824511918 27863584 14840409917
79495006578 9680646
79495006578 9680646
313 92 79179253
All about undefined
Interested in learning more?
79495006578 9680646
313 92 79179253
See more
15 98
6363 992 6314 53472
See more
704955842 0709
66 134807 9099154 66768
See more